Full Description

Show more
AMENDMENT TO CLOSING TIME: Please disregard the Ariba Discovery posting response deadline closing time and CanadaBuys posting closing time. All required supporting documentation and bid submission must be submitted by July 8, 2026 at 2:00pm EDT. All bids submitted after 2:00pm EDT will result in the bid being declared non-responsive. To provide Janitorial Services including all labour, material and equipment for Public Works and Government Services Canada (PWGSC), located at 3545 Leitrim Road, Ottawa, Ontario. The services must be provided in accordance with the Statement of Work. Canada is currently assessing the possibility of holding an additional optional site visit. Further details, including the date, time and attendance requirements, will be provided by amendment, if applicable.
